First, we have decided there are 3 different type of swaps.
Version 1: full stealth smog police
Version 2: 2.8/3.1 top, with 3.4 bottom and accessorys (project85)
Version 3: Full 3.4 SFI swap (includes ecm, accssorys, wireharness)
Included here is for version 1. I have done the version 3, but it is not worth it on a mpfi engine.
A: pre pulling your current engine
A1: Get your engine
A2: Before you do anything else, if you have a fan sensor in the rear of your right head (2.8guys), do what you feel is safe to get the plug out of that spot on your 3.4
A3: stop by your local parts store and get
A3-1. Full rebuild gasket set for your current desgin engine (me it was 91 3.1)
A3-2. Oil mount gasket (from gm dealer)
A3-3. Tube of clear silicone
A3-4. Injector o rings
A3-5. Timing chain
A3-6. 3.4 spark plugs (r43tsk)
A3-7. t-stat
A3-8. oil and oil filter
A3-9. any questionable parts that you don’t trust the intergity of (belts, alt, coil, sp wires, water pump)
A3-10. Freeze plugs for the 3.4 if you want too
A3-11. Performance cam shaft if you want too
A3-12. New oil pump if you want too
A4: rotate your 3.4 to piston 1 top dead center
A5: pull the fuel rail out of your 3.4, remove the injectors, put them in a ziplock bag and put them in a safe place, you need these.
A6: pull all engine accessorys off the 3.4, the y-intake, the coils, the valve covers, lower intake, crank pully, balancer, water pump, timing cover, exhaust manifolds, motor mounts, starter, oil pan, distrib plug/oil pump drive. Put the balancer with your injectors as you need this. Rest, push off to the side, you don’t need it any more. This should leave you with a block, heads, crank, connecting rods, pistons, cam, timing chain, lifters, pushrods, rockers.
A7: install your new timing chain (and cam shaft if choosen)
A8: on the right side, you have a knock sensor, it needs to be moved down to a different plug down by where the starter was. Swap the sensor and screw in plug around.
A9: you have 2 sensors in the 3.4 that the 2.8/3.1 doesn’t use. You can remove them and fill with new freeze plugs if you wish. Most just leave them in the engine.
A10: install all freeze plugs if you are going that route.
A11: flywheel/flexplate. If your 3.4 came with the proper fly/flex, leave it on. If not, we must do something about it. It is advised against to use your 2.8 one. 3.1 guys can re-use the one on the engine. This is because most 2.8’s are exteranlly balanced, where 3.1 and 3.4 are internal. So, 2.8 guys, go get a 3.1 or 3.4 fly/flexplate.
This should leave you with a 3.4 that’s ready for the 2.8/3.1 goodies.
B: Pulling Your engine
B1: before you pull your engine, pull the distrib out, drain all fluids. Advise pulling most of your engine accssorys off as sometimes these things get bumped and damaged in this process. Label any wire and connection so that you will know what it goes to when you drop the new one back in.
B2: pull the engine
B3: Clean your engine bay, check your radiator, any hoses, wiring, and rubber motor mounts. Now is the time to replace it if needed.
C: Swaping parts from current engine to new engine.
C1: start with the timing chain cover, put it on the new engine with water pump, 3.4 balancer, crank pully, wp pully.
C2: Bring your 2.8/3.1 oil pan over, install with new gasket. (oil pump if you decided to do that)
C3: Bring your exhaust manifolds over. Reason for this is that the 3.4 ones have o2 sensor holes, and possibly not your proper smog holes.
C4: Bring your oil filter mount over.
C5: Bring your motor mount brackets over.
C6: Bring your base intake over, and set/adjust your rockers per the manual (if no manual, please search my user name, ALONG time ago I re-typed it strait from the GM manual).
C7: install new t-stat and goose neck.
C8: Install clutch or you manual guys
D: Install new engine.
D1: Put your new engine in, carefully watching that you don’t set it on any wires or hoses.
D2: Now re-connect your exhaust FIRST, you may have to rock, move wiggle engine around to make it bolt up
D3: Bolt it to your transmission, then the motor mounts and re-connect everything under the car.
E: Finish swapping accssorys over
E1: Now re-install your 2.8/3.1 power steering, alt, ac, smog
E2: install the 3.4 injectors into your existing 2.8/3.1 fuel rail
E3: install the disributor into the block per the manual. You may have to take needle nose and rotate the oil pump shaft.
E3: Install everything else…..valve covers, coil, sp wires, new 3.4 plugs, middle intake, fuel rail, upper intake, belt, etc.
E4: 2.8 guys, don’t forget about that fan sensor in the right head.
E5: make sure you did get a good ground on the back of the heads, and the wire from the battery.
E6: put on new oil filter and fill with fluids.
You now should be good to start it up and set timing and install fluids. May have to re-adjust your detent cable on the automatics.

2 plugs on a 2.8 you have to deal with, 1 on a 3.1.
2.8.
Plug in right rear head. The heads are designed to fit left or right. It is an "innie" plug, thats the worst freakin thing to ever remove.
plug on right side of block, down low, rear by the starter. Just a wrech will remove this one. Put some silicone or tufflon thread locker on it before you put it back in the block on the right side, up high, front.

F-body
2.8 Carb LC1 82-84 107@4800/145@2100 8.5:1 comp 3.50 borex3.00 stroke
2.8 MPFI LB8 85-89 135@5100/165@3900 8.9:1 comp 3.50 borex3.00 stroke
3.1 MPFI LH0 90-92 140@4400/185@3600 8.5:1 comp 3.50 borex3.31 stroke
3.4 SFI L32 93-95 160@4600/200@3600 9.0:1 comp 3.62 borex3.31 stroke
S10
2.8 carb LR2 vin "b" 110@4800/148@2000 8.5:1 comp (83-85)
2.8 TBI LL2 vin "r"125@4800/150@2200 8.5:1 comp (86-88)
2.8 TBI LL2 vin "r" 125@4800/150@2200 8.9:1 comp (89-93)
Fiero
2.8 MPFI 85-89 ... 140@??/??@???? 8.9:1 comp

Putty knife and pry the intake up. Dont use a screw driver, you may gouge the sealing surface.
You can also carefully remove the studs with a very small socket, or vise grips(watch the threads). Then intake should move more freely.

Leave your 3.1 ecm in the car, you DO NOT do anything with the ecm or any harness work.
The 4l60e or whatever came behind the 3.4 will not work in your car w/o modding the harness/ecm. Leave your 700r4 or have it rebuilt if wish.

Some of the very very late 2.8's have neutral balanced balancers, but your better safe using a 3.1/3.4.
Here is the info behind this.
Back in the old days, the flex/fly, crank, and balancer were all balanced in unison and if you had to replace one of them, it had to be balanced with all the other parts.
Depending upon the motor, depends on the year where all this stuff went to self balanced. Meaning you could replace one, and not worry about the others.
For the 6/60 motors, this was the late 80's.

Since when does a 91 have a 4l60E? The electronic controls (other than the torque converter clutch) were introduced in 1994 to the 700R4 (which was renamed the 4L60 in 92 due to a Fed regulation). Unless it was swapped in with a custom ECM or external trans controller (more than likely an external controller as the available 94-95 ECMs were not programmable), it's not a 4L60E, which has more than 5 wires going to it (2 for VSS and 3 for the TCC and gear switch).
I'd do the shift kit and a Vette 2-3 servo kit before the trans gets mated to the engine, just to freshen things up a bit. Although, if the fluid that's in it looks burnt, you may end up with a clutch pack failure in the future (even without the shift kit and new servo due to increased torque load from the bigger engine). Also, think about an aftermarket converter as well.

If the trans was a 4L60E, the service manual would show a lot more solenoids in the wiring locations diagrams than just the 3rd and 4th gear switches and the torque converter clutch solenoid. Again, the 4L60E wasn't used until 1994 with the 3.4 4th gen.

The only parts you need to swap from the 3.1 are the fuel rail and upper plenum (maybe the intake manifold to heater core pipe), and the accessory brackets and accessories, along with any possible sensors that don't match. The fuel injectors and everything below stay with the 3.4. Do a water pump and as many gaskets as you can while the engine is out.
